German armoured vehicle fires on Afghan hotel

International peacekeepers were today investigating an incident in which a German armoured vehicle fired on the Intercontinental Hotel in the Afghan capital.

No one was injured in what British Major Angela Herbert, a spokeswoman for International Security Assistance Forces responsible for security in Kabul, called an accident.

But an Associated Press reporter counted 20 bullet holes in a transmission truck for Afghan national television outside the hotel.

Herbert said it was unclear why the mounted machine gun on the vehicle, known as a ‘‘Dingo’’, opened fire. She said the gun’s controls are inside the vehicle.
